We are seeking a highly organised and proactive Personal Assistant to provide Freelance comprehensive administrative support to our Managing Director. We are looking for a highly efficient, PA to handle the logistics and clear roadblocks. This is not a traditional desk job. It is a hybrid role that combines Junior Executive Assistance (admin, data) with Operational Support (logistics, prep, practical support). Your goal is to optimise time so the MD can focus on high-level work.
Duties may include
Managing and maintaining executive calendars, scheduling appointments, and coordinating meetings
Handling incoming calls with professional phone etiquette and directing enquiries appropriately
Organising travel arrangements, including booking flights, accommodation, and transportation
Preparing and editing documents using Microsoft Office and Google Workspace applications
Ensuring professional attire (shirts/suits) is ready, ironed and suitable for client meetings.
Packing, resetting equipment bags for travel and daily schedules to ensure punctuality.
Acting as an internal courier physically managing thing such as, Amazon returns, and local procurement errands in Hove and surrounding areas.
Scanning and uploading receipts to accounting software (Dext), filing documentation, and sitting on hold with vendors/service providers
Office Standards: Clearing the workspace of deliveries/packaging and resetting the home office environment for deep work.
Performing data entry tasks accurately within QuickBooks and other relevant software programmes
Managing correspondence via email, whatsapp and traditional mail, ensuring timely responses
Assisting with administrative tasks such as filing, printing, and organising files
Supporting the team with various clerical duties to ensure efficient office operations
Maintaining confidentiality of sensitive information at all times
